Depression is a widespread disease, especially among patients with coronary heart disease (CHD), and has been identified as an independent risk factor for sudden cardiac arrest (SCA) and CHD‐related mortality. 1, 2 Antidepressants are among the most commonly prescribed classes of medication. 3 However, tricyclic … WebJul 2, 2024 · Heart disease and depression. Depression is common in people with CHD. It is associated with higher risk of death due to cardiovascular causes and so it is important that it is well-managed. ... Citalopram causes dose dependent QT interval prolongation and is generally avoided in CHD. WebDec 5, 2024 · Parkinson’s disease (PD) is one of the most common neurodegenerative disorders with a global burden of approximately 6.1 million patients. Alpha-synuclein has been linked to both the sporadic and familial forms of the disease. Moreover, alpha-synuclein is present in Lewy-bodies, the neuropathological hallmark of PD, and the …
